FAQs - booking Corsica flights

  • I’m staying in Porto Vecchio. Which airport is closest?

    The airport closest to Porto Vecchio is Figari-Sud Corse Airport in the south of the island, which is around 30min from the city centre by car. If you’re travelling off-season or would like to have more options when it comes to flight routes and airlines, consider booking a flight to Paris and then flying from there to Ajaccio Napoleon Bonaparte Airport. This airport is approx. 2h 30min drive away from Porto Vecchio.

  • Which airport is closest to Sartène?

    This depends on the time of year you're booking your flight to Corsica. If you’re travelling during high season, the closest airport to Sartène is Figari-Sud, which is at least 50min away by car. But because Figari-Sud is only served by seasonal flights, if you’re travelling to Corsica any other time of year you’ll need to book a flight to Corsica via Paris and fly into Ajaccio Napoleon Bonaparte, around 1h 30min drive away from Sartène.

  • I’m staying in Ajaccio. Which airport in Corsica should I fly into?

    Ajaccio is served by Ajaccio Napoleon Bonaparte Airport, about 20min away from the city centre. This airport has limited options when it comes to airlines and routes from the United Kingdom, with direct flights to Corsica from London only operated by two airlines. Passengers flying from elsewhere in the UK will have at least one stopover, either in London or in mainland France.

  • Which airport do I fly into to visit Sant’Antonino?

    The medieval village of Sant’Antonino is located on the north side of the island, which is served by two airports. The closest to Sant’Antonino is Calvi-Saint-Catherine Airport, approx. 30min away by car. However, there is only one weekly direct flight to Corsica from the United Kingdom that lands at this airport, and the route is only serviced from May to October. If you need to be more flexible with your travel dates or want more options when it comes to airlines and routes, you can book your flight to Corsica to Bastia instead. This airport is around a 1h 30min drive from Sant’Antonino.

  • All direct flights to Corsica from destinations in the United Kingdom are seasonal, so if you’re planning to visit the French island off-season you can expect to have a stopover in a French city like Paris, Lyon, Marseille or Nice. Air France and Air Corsica operate direct flights to Corsica from the French mainland all year round.
  • With the island served by four airports, when searching for flights to Corsica select Bastia-Poretta Airport (BIA) in the north of the island if you want more choices of airlines and departure airports in the United Kingdom. This airport is served by seasonal direct flights from London, Manchester, Birmingham and Southampton.
  • Calvi-Sainte-Catherine Airport (CLY) also serves the north of the island, but direct flights to Corsica from the United Kingdom that land here are seasonal and limited, only operated by Air Corsica from London Stansted (STN).
  • Figari-Sud Corse Airport (FSC) serves mainly the south side of the island, with seasonal flights to Corsica from London. British Airways operates flights from London Heathrow, Air Corsica from London Stansted, and easyJet from Gatwick Airport.
  • On the west side, the island is served by Ajaccio Napoleon Bonaparte Airport (AJA), with seasonal flights to Corsica from London.
